About The Swedish eHealth Agency

The Swedish eHealth Agency is a government agency founded in 2014, based in Kalmar, tasked with building and maintaining Sweden's national eHealth infrastructure. The agency develops digital health services, national medication registries, and data solutions for healthcare professionals and decision-makers across the country. Core focus areas include e-prescriptions, medication statistics, pharmacological analysis, and a data warehouse for analytics and AI. Operations are regulation-heavy, governed by healthcare privacy law and medical device compliance requirements. The organization employs 201–500 staff across engineering, healthcare, legal, quality, and data functions, with hiring concentrated in Sweden.

Frequently Asked Questions

What tech stack does the Swedish eHealth Agency use?

Primary stack includes Java, Spring Boot, Quarkus, Jakarta EE, Kubernetes, Docker, and OpenShift. Frontend uses Vue, React, and Angular. Data and workflow tools include Hibernate, Jenkins, and GitLab. Architecture frameworks include ArchiMate and UML.

What projects is the Swedish eHealth Agency working on?

Active projects include national medication registry (nationella läkemedelslistan), medication information service (läkemedelskollen), pharmacological analysis, data warehouse for statistics and AI, patient-safe product development, and continuous quality process improvement.
